About the preschool

The new nursery school at Hallgerðargata is tailored to the needs of young children from the ages of 12 months to three years. Children aged 12 to 24 months are enrolled, and parents need to apply for a transfer at the beginning of the year their child turns 3 years old. The preschool houses 60 children and operates in two divisions. Nursery schools take in children aged 12 to 24 months. You need to apply for a transfer to another preschool in the year your child turns 3 years old. The preschool has two locations; the other location is the nursery school in Bríetartún.

City of Reykjavík preschools follow the National Preschool Curriculum with reference to the Reykjavík City Education Policy. It focuses on encouraging children's discovery and play and making them active participants in a democratic society.

Philosophy

Nursery schools give special attention to good care, communications, and language development and language stimulation is the core of all school activities. The philosophy of creative work and exploratory play are paramount along with music, movement, singing, physical stimulation, and the outdoors. We work with language stimulation material emphasizing visual planning through conversation.

Child prosperity

The Act on the Integration of Services in the Interest of Children’s Prosperity has come into effect. The goal is to ensure children and guardians receive the right assistance, at the right time, from the right parties.

Families and children in need of early support have guaranteed access to a prosperity contact in the child's immediate environment, such as in preschool or primary school. The prosperity contact offers information and guidance on services and ensures that children and guardians have unhindered access to these services.

Children, youth, and guardians can reach the school prosperity contact to request integrated services.
